Steve O’Brien’s latest novel, Dead Money (A&N Publishing, ISBN 978-0-9881843-0-5, $14.95), zeroes in on the dark side of horse racing, where the wrong wager could cost you your life, not just the contents of your wallet.
The stranger’s menacing, dismissive laughter echoed in attorney Dan Morgan’s head. In the heart of thoroughbred country--Churchill Downs--a major con was about to be pulled. Despite Dan’s efforts, his filly, Aly Dancer, was somehow part of the scheme. (Read more)
